Output 00840ff3c9ab8072ca61ba450c332fb5127b6e2c19d8f63eb5e26a9c8fef1ebd:1

value
8310754990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 346d02ef5c9372dd85e74dcfbab18cfdbc0055a0 OP_EQUAL
address
36UDemWpFKjvPuneFwHgtrh5qLscTpf6dq
transaction
00840ff3c9ab8072ca61ba450c332fb5127b6e2c19d8f63eb5e26a9c8fef1ebd
confirmations
200245
spent
true